The impact of novel alternative accesses and valve type on radiation exposure during transcatheter aortic valve replacement (TAVR) have not been evaluated yet. This study sought to determine the impact of (i) transarterial approach and (ii) prosthesis type on physician and patient exposure to radiation during TAVR. This was a prospective study including 140 consecutive patients undergoing TAVR by transfemoral (TF) (n=102) or transcarotid (TC) (n=38) access in 2 centers.
